WebMaintenance: Low – Moderate General Care & Growing Tips: Firebush flowers best in full sun, but foliage is usually more attractive when grown in shade. Fertilize sparingly and mulch the root zone to keep out competing grass and weeds. It can take heat and drought, but may require supplemental irrigation from time to time. WebA flower mite, Proctolaelaps kirmsei, lives on and consumes the resources, nectar and pollen, of firebush flowers. During the dark hours after midnight, the tiny mites, about a half a millimeter long, consume as much as 50 percent of the pollen. Before dawn, the flowers begin producing nectar.
